got PTSD from RSD Posted March 7, 2017 Share Posted March 7, 2017 41 minutes ago, ethanpricington said: Makes sense - thanks for the insight! Just my two cents on this issue. No one that replied is incorrect, but in my opinion it is more a matter of "controlling the narrative" than it is a desire to "get things right". I can't remember a year that the list wasn't revised multiple times even after the official release. The list is going to be a snapshot in time, no matter if it is released 3 months before RSD or 3 days before RSD. Of course it will be more accurate the closer you get to the actual day, but things are changing right up until the end due to both clerical errors and unforeseen circumstances. RSD wants to control the release of this information so they can control the story. They have worked hard all year (in many cases for several years) to bring these releases to fruition so they (deservedly) want to be the ones to reveal the fruits of their labor to the world. If we divulge the whole list now then who is going to want to pay attention to their long-planned big reveal in a few weeks? For me, the real question is, why wouldn't the folks who run RSD release the list to the public at the same time they release it to the stores? One theory is that perhaps the folks at RSD want the stores to feel the pressure of having to make the relatively quick decision about which of these hundreds of titles they should carry, without the benefit of customer input. No store wants to be the lame shop that didn't order enough copies of those one or two titles that people are willing to camp overnight for. So we might as well cast a wide net, right? If the store was allowed to share the list with their customers and had adequate time to do so, many of the same criticisms about certain titles that surface in this thread would undoubtedly be voiced to store owners. In that world, all of these unsold ghosts of RSD past would be moldering in an RSD warehouse somewhere instead of haunting the racks at my shop. Like I said, just my two cents. scottheisel 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
